Output 75e8c93efb455162328382dae1c5714a23b49d41ed9f3fe28b3d47239232111b:2

value
52928299
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ea8904342a992c61a05cf98f00f23d46a1fecbe OP_EQUALVERIFY OP_CHECKSIG
address
16iJptmmk5dzvegTSb5t1dX9kLC4uT69oY
transaction
75e8c93efb455162328382dae1c5714a23b49d41ed9f3fe28b3d47239232111b
spent
true